Ultrasound images are very noisy. Along with system noise, a significant noise source is the speckle phenomenon caused by interference in the viewed object. Most of the past approaches for denoising ultrasound images essentially blur the image and they do not handle attenuation. We discuss an approach that does not blur the image and handles attenuation.
